October 24 is world Polio Day .
A global day to raise Awareness and resources for the worldwide effort to eradicate Polio .

Rotarians comprising 15 Rotary clubs in Warri South ,Uvwie ,Okpe ,Ughelli North and south local Government Areas of Delta state under Rotary international District 9141 came out en-masse to create awareness of the need to keep Polio in Nigeria at zero -free .

The theme for 2023 world Polio day is “A healthier future for mothers and children.”

Polio is a highly contagious viral infection that can lead to paralysis and even death in severe cases .

To sustain the campaign Rotary International has been at the forefront of eradicating polio and is committed to keeping it status at zero not only in Nigeria but also worldwide.
So far, over the last 3 decades, Rotarians through Rotary International have contributed over $2.9 billion with the aim to eradicate this preventable disease.

15 clubs in Warri South ,Uvwie ,Okpe ,Ughelli North and south local Government Areas under District 9141 led by the presidents of the clubs walked from Refinery junction through various streets in Uvwie local government to Angle park junction in Warri South local government Areas to encourage parents to take their children under the ages of zero to 5 to the nearest health centre for immunization against Polio .

Rotarians during world Polio mega walk

Some of the Presidents stated that Rotary club is committed to sustain the country’s zero polio status.

They enjoined stakeholders to join hands with Rotary club in ensuring that every deserving child was vaccinated and polio remained at zero in the country .
